mostly I'm just starting this because hasbro revealed the next toyline, War for Cybertron Trilogy - Kingdom, or just Kingdom for short. it's got nothing to do with the War for Cybertron video game which I hear was actually pretty rad, but i didn't play it.

Nah, War for Cybertron Trilogy is basically the current series of Generations toylines. The generations toylines are basically just "it's the old characters you liked (and some new stuff we made), but now with newer, more modern design ideas and gimmicks. and also revisting G1 stuff a lot because it was popular." And the previous two toylines, Siege and Earthrise, have been a lot of that.

Siege was basically G1, but everyone's on cybertron so everyone turns into future vehicles because they're not trying to disguise themselves. Also everyone has battle damage paint apps. And everyone has a billion ports on the sides because some figures come apart and can be used by other figures as guns and armor and shit. It's pretty cool.

Earthrise (which is currently going on, but hasn't fully overtaken Siege on the shelves yet, probobly due to 2020 in general throwing a spanner in the works for everyone) is basically, they're all on earth now, so now it's actual G1 nonsense and robots in disguise. also leaning more into base-building thanks to some figures that can come apart and transform into little bases for micromasters, as well as other larger figures including accessories and modes that also help lean into that a bit, like the Optimus Prime figure for this line having a trailer that can be set up as a base, or the new Sky Lynx figure that can transform into a shuttle launch facility
